摘要
为充分利用秸秆资源,更好发挥现代农机装备作用,设置4种小麦秸秆还田/玉米播种模式,研究耕层土壤含水量、有机质质量分数、玉米播种质量、生长发育、产量和经济效益差异。结果表明:秸秆粉碎免耕播种保墒效果好,植株抗倒,但秸秆抛撒不匀常造成播种机入土部件挂草壅堵、缺苗断垄。翻埋秸秆旋耕播种当季有机质增加较多,但保墒效果差,倒伏风险较大,环节多成本高。秸秆打捆免耕播种还田量少,但出苗较好,保墒、抗倒,产量较高,且增加了秸秆收入。洁区播种可一次完成小麦秸秆粉碎、玉米播种、秸秆覆盖,且播种质量高、保墒抗倒效果好,增产明显,经济效益最佳。说明提高播种质量、确保单位面积穗数是玉米高产的基础,播种区域相对"洁净"是提高播种质量的关键,秸秆覆盖起到蓄水保墒作用,免耕播种玉米抗倒能力强,洁区播种模式实现了以上要素的结合,节本增效显著,值得大力推广。
        In order to make full use of straw resources and better play the role of modern agricultural machinery and equipment, four wheat straw returning/maize sowing patterns were set up to study the difference of soil moisture content, organic mass fraction, sowing quality, maize growth, yield and economic efficiency. The results showed that: straw power and no-tillage planting had good effect on moisture conservation, and the plants were resistant to lodging, but the uneven dispersion straw often caused the planter to hang grass and block the sowing ports;the effect of moisture conservation by burying the straw was poor,but it had the higher risk of lodging and the high cost;the emergence of straw baling and no-tillage planting were better, the moisture conservation of soil was better, the plant was resistant to lodging, and the yield was higher, and the straw income was increased;sowing in the clean area could complete wheat straw grinding, maize sowing and straw mulching at one time, and the emergence quality was high, the moisture conservation of soil was better, the plant resistant to lodging was good, the increase of the yield was obvious, and the economic benefit was best. In conclusion,the foundation for high yield of maize is laid to improve the quality of sowing and ensure the number of panicles per unit area.The key to improve the quality of sowing is keep relatively clean in the planting area. The straw coverage plays the role of water storage and preservation. Planting maize with no-tillage is resistant to lodging.The patterns of the sowing in clean area has combinned all above element,this cost-saving synergy is remarkable and is very worth promoting.
